'politicians Perpetrating Illegality At Inec Office To Change Candidates Names' by jadesoletee(m): 9:05am On Oct 23, 2018
Some desperate politicians have connived with the leadership of their various political parties to form an unholy alliance with some staff of INEC to engage in illegal changing of names already submitted to the Commission after the October 18 deadline.

A reliable source that pleaded anonymity informed that politicians from the contentious states are the ones mostly seen at the INEC office buying their ways into illegality in obvious contravention of timetable released by the electoral body.

The source further informed that it was unclear if the INEC leadership was aware of the ongoing name changing. Although, the source informed that the name changing has been ongoing for some days now, but only became more pronounced on Monday.

Meanwhile, the ongoing name changing is not same as the official substitution of names by registered political parties. The source said, " What is ongoing at the ICT Centre of INEC is a clear illegality by desperate politicians in collusion with the leadership of their political parties. The deadline given by INEC for official submission of names by all the political parties had since elapsed and any other thing to the contrary at this time is a clear act of illegality ". A source disclosed that some incumbent members of the National Assembly are still laying siege in the Aso Drive residence of the chairman of one of the major political parties to put pressure on him to sign new CF002 forms to facilitate the illegal substitution of names.

However, candidates whose names have been officially submitted to INEC by their political parties have called on the leadership of electoral umpire not to allow anything that will tamper with official lists submitted to the Commission at the close of nomination on 18th October 2018. A House of Representatives candidate from Imo State has called on INEC Chairman to immediately investigate the allegation of name swapping and not hesitate to severely sanction any of its staff that is involved in the ignoble act that is capable of denting the integrity of the
electoral body





.
